Micra scores 3rd place in Car of the Year
24 January 2011
The Nissan Micra K13 has taken out third place in the Wheels Car of the Year Awards, behind the Volkswagen Polo and Renault Megane.

Nissan’s Micra made the magazine's top three finalist's stage with its low cost and great handling. As Wheels Magazine editor Bill Thomas said, "The Nissan Micra is the best car ever sold for under $13,000 in Australia.”

The judges loved Nissan's new 56kW DOHC three-cylinder engine, for its distinctive revvy character.The triple responds to enthusiastic driving; the harder you rev it and the quicker you shift gears, the better it becomes and the more impressive the handling and surprising grip can be exploited.

Where the Micra best succeeds is as a runabout. It's such an easy car to drive: light controls, excellent visibility, good brakes, and a comfortable ride, for a fine balance between low-speed compliance and higher-speed stability, without excessive body roll. Compared with similarly priced entry-level Korean and Japanese cars it truly sets new standards.

The judges liked the Micra's modern and exceptionally roomy, four-seater interior, especially in the Ti versions, with their classy circular climate control unit and LCD screen.

As an affordable $13K city car it's unrivaled, a near perfectly resolved and charming package.
